Yes, he does a great job of pointing out how media debases the language. So unilateralism is inherently bad and multilateralism is inherently good?

Perhaps the greatest example of "multilateral" military action was the Nazi invasion of the Soviet Union. Think of the vast multilateral coalition! Germans, Austrians, Romanians, Czechs, Finns, Spaniards, Bulgarians, and Italians all united together to attack Communist Russia, which in turn had no other combatants on its front but unilaterally-minded Russians.
